Fungi reproduce sexually and/or asexually. Some fungi reproduce both sexually and asexually, while different fungi reproduce solely asexually (by mitosis). In each sexual and asexual reproduction, fungi produce spores that disperse from the guardian organism by either floating on the wind or best blood circulation supplement hitching a experience on an animal. Fungal spores are smaller and lighter than plant seeds. For instance, the enormous puffball mushroom bursts open and releases trillions of spores in a large cloud of what seems like finely particulate mud. Fungi reproduce asexually by fragmentation, budding, or producing spores. Fragments of hyphae can develop new colonies. Somatic cells in yeast type buds. The most typical mode of asexual reproduction is thru the formation of asexual spores, which are produced by a single individual thallus (by mitosis) and are genetically equivalent to the mum or dad thallus (Figure 24.8). Spores enable fungi to expand their distribution and colonize new environments.

Experiments have been carried out where nerves have been uncovered to aglycaemia and the CAP recorded till it started to fall, a sign that glycogen was depleted. The CAP was allowed to get well to its baseline value and then aglycemia was introduced again, the idea being that the glycogen won’t be replenished to its baseline degree. The latency to CAP failure during this second period of aglycemia was shortened compared to the first interval of aglycemia (Brown et al., 2003). The position of glycogen underneath extra physiological conditions was investigated. Within the presence of two mM glucose, which is considered to be hypoglycemic and a systemic concentration that is reached in type 1 diabetic patients who mismatch insulin delivery with prevailing glucose ranges, the CAP is maintained for Healthy Flow Blood offers extended durations of time. However depleting glucose by imposing a interval of aglycemia and then reintroducing 2 mM glucose led to CAP failure, indicating that by itself 2 mM glucose isn’t adequate to help the CAP, however is supplemented by the breakdown of glycogen to offer supplemental power substrate (Brown et al., 2003). Removing that source of glycogen-derived substrate leads to CAP failure, indicating that in type 1 diabetic patients, throughout durations of hypoglycemia, glycogen is damaged down to supply supplemental substrate to support brain operate.

A issue in looking at grey matter is that the interactions and range of cells exceeds that of the white matter optic nerve, thus results can be complicated. It is tempting to rely on such lowered less complicated programs as tissue culture, but the translatability of these to the in vivo mind should not totally convincing. This is very true the place below in vivo situations there is a big intracellular compartment and a small interstitial area, whereas under tissue tradition conditions the extracellular volume i.e., the media, is infinitely large compared to the intracellular compartments. It is particularly difficult to evaluate the degree of cell-to-cell communication beneath tissue tradition circumstances. Thus the ANLSH data proposed by Pellerin and Magistretti, who derived their speculation from tissue tradition experiments, must be seen beneath these situations. Unfortunately, there isn’t a system that’s as simple or compartmentalized because the honeybee retina, so a majority of these experiment tend to be compromises at greatest, with conjecture and implication replacing convincing experimental proof.
